a model rocket blasts off with a constant acceleration of 12.3m/s until it’s fuel runs out 10.2s later. It then enters free fall for the remainder of its flight. What is the total time the rocket was in the air?

h=0.5at2=0.5(12.3)(10.2)2=640 mh=0.5at^2=0.5(12.3)(10.2)^2=640\ m

0=h+vT0.5gT20=h+atT0.5gT20=640+(12.3)(10.2)T0.5(9.8)T2T=30.0 s0=h+vT-0.5gT^2\to 0=h+atT-0.5gT^2\\0=640+(12.3)(10.2)T-0.5(9.8)T^2\\T=30.0\ s

The  total time is


t+T=10.2+30=40.2 st+T=10.2+30=40.2\ s
